Dubai, Jan 2: Seeking to put the sparkle back into the gold trade after a less than stellar showing in the second half of 2012, Dubai’s jewellers are set to put their marketing muscle behind 18-carat jewellery for the first time. They believe such a move would help considerably improve offtake of jewellery among Western and Chinese shoppers, particularly tourists during the peak holiday season and during DSF.

It also signals a not so subtle shift on the part of Dubai’s jewellery trade which has until now focussed exclusively on 22-carat jewellery and demand from Indian and Pakistani residents and those on visit.

“18K is the most popular caratage in jewellery internationally, especially in Europe; hence it will be appealing to tourists from there,” said Abdul Salam KP, group executive director at Malabar Gold and Diamonds. “It obviously has the advantage of a lower price compared to 22K and offers more design variety as it is acceptable internationally and easier to make in complicated designs.”

On pricing, there is a fairly significant gap between the carats. Yesterday, a gram of 22K was going for Dh180.94 ($49.26) in Dubai, while its 18K counterpart had a less sheen in value terms at Dh147.99 ($40.29) a gram. Moreover, the making charges on 18K are said to be considerably lower.

Apart from the Western tourist, jewellery chains are keeping an equally keen look out for Chinese shoppers. They were quite conspicuous jewellery buyers during DSF 2011, but less so last year. Retailers are hoping for a marked improvement in the upcoming one and expect the 18K push will win them over.

“The Chinese tourist prefer 18K gold jewellery as well as 24K gold bars,” said John Paul Joy Alukkas, executive director, Joyalukkas Group. “The preference for the former is because they can use it more as a day to day rather than special occasion jewellery. The gold bars are with an investment perspective.”

Dubai’s gold trade definitely needs a volume boost and if 18K can provide that, retailers will not mind much. Demand had taken a dent last year after the steady upturn in gold prices through 2011 stalled and went through a bit of volatility.

But a key factor for the subdued demand had to do with events in India, where customs authorities dusted off a long dormant 1967 gold import duty and started applying it vigorously since the second quarter of 2012. This effectively meant that the price differential buying gold jewellery in Dubai as opposed to doing the same in India came down significantly. It also meant that any Indian expat here taking gold back to India would be hit with steep duties. As a case in point, a woman passenger wearing a gold chain weighing 40-gram would have to shell out Rs4,100 as duty on arrival at an Indian airport.

“Implementation of the recent revision in customs duty for gold and the related hassles for passengers has affected the mindset of NRI passengers in a big way,” said Sunny Chittilappilly, chairman of Dubai Gold and Jewellery Group. “As a result gold buying in the Gulf reduced to an extent and demand for 22K Indian jewellery was affected during the high purchase season close to summer.”

Several depositions, both individual and at the industry level, have been made to the Indian authorities for a repeal or a relook at the 1967 provisions. Dubai’s jewellers believe something will come out of the collective action.

In the meantime, they hope the 18K push and DSF 2013 — in which 13 kilos of gold can be won daily - will cut them some slack.

Washington, Aug 2: Children under the age of five have between 10 to 100 times greater levels of genetic material of the coronavirus in their noses compared to older children and adults, a study in JAMA Pediatrics said Thursday.

Its authors wrote this meant that young children might be important drivers of Covid-19 transmission within communities -- a suggestion at odds with the current prevailing narrative.

The paper comes as the administration of US President Donald Trump is pushing hard for schools and daycare to reopen in order to kickstart the economy.

Between March 23 and April 27, researchers carried out nasal swab tests on 145 Chicago patients with mild to moderate illness within one week of symptom onset.

The patients were divided into three groups: 46 children younger than five-years-old, 51 children aged five to 17 years, and 48 adults aged 18 to 65 years.

The team, led by Dr Taylor Heald-Sargent of the Ann & Robert H. Lurie Children's Hospital, observed, "a 10-fold to 100-fold greater amount of SARS-CoV-2 in the upper respiratory tract of young children."

The authors added that a recent lab study had demonstrated that the more viral genetic material was present, the more infectious virus could be grown.

It has also previously been shown that children with high viral loads of the respiratory syncytial virus (RSV) are more likely to spread the disease.

"Thus, young children can potentially be important drivers of SARS-CoV-2 spread in the general population," the authors wrote.

"Behavioral habits of young children and close quarters in school and daycare settings raise concern for SARS-CoV-2 amplification in this population as public health restrictions are eased," they concluded.

The new findings are at odds with the current view among health authorities that young children -- who, it has been well established, are far less likely to fall seriously ill from the virus -- don't spread it much to others either.

However, there has been fairly little research on the topic so far.

One recent study in South Korea found children aged 10 to 19 transmitted Covid-19 within households as much as adults, but children under nine transmitted the virus at lower rates.

New York, Feb 26:  A new wearable sensor that works in conjunction with artificial intelligence (AI) technology could help doctors remotely detect critical changes in heart failure patients days before a health crisis occurs, says a study.

The researchers said the system could eventually help avert up to one in three heart failure readmissions in the weeks following initial discharge from the hospital and help patients sustain a better quality of life.

"This study shows that we can accurately predict the likelihood of hospitalisation for heart failure deterioration well before doctors and patients know that something is wrong," says the study's lead author Josef Stehlik from University of Utah in the US.

"Being able to readily detect changes in the heart sufficiently early will allow physicians to initiate prompt interventions that could prevent rehospitalisation and stave off worsening heart failure," Stehlik added.

According to the researchers, even if patients survive, they have poor functional capacity, poor exercise tolerance and low quality of life after hospitalisations.

"This patch, this new diagnostic tool, could potentially help us prevent hospitalizations and decline in patient status," Stehlik said.

For the findings, published in the journal Circulation: Heart Failure, the researchers followed 100 heart failure patients, average age 68, who were diagnosed and treated at four veterans administration (VA) hospitals in Utah, Texas, California, and Florida.

After discharge, participants wore an adhesive sensor patch on their chests 24 hours a day for up to three months.

The sensor monitored continuous electrocardiogram (ECG) and motion of each subject.

This information was transmitted from the sensor via Bluetooth to a smartphone and then passed on to an analytics platform, developed by PhysIQ, on a secure server, which derived heart rate, heart rhythm, respiratory rate, walking, sleep, body posture and other normal activities.

Using artificial intelligence, the analytics established a normal baseline for each patient. When the data deviated from normal, the platform generated an indication that the patient's heart failure was getting worse.

Overall, the system accurately predicted the impending need for hospitalization more than 80 per cent of the time.

On average, this prediction occurred 10.4 days before a readmission took place (median 6.5 days), the study said.

COVID-19 mostly kills through an overreaction of the immune system, whose function is precisely to fight infections, say scientists who have decoded the mechanisms, symptoms, and diagnosis of the disease caused by the SARS-Cov-2 coronavirus.

In a study published in the journal Frontiers in Public Health, the researchers explained step-by-step how the virus infects the airways, multiplies inside cells, and in severe cases causes the immune defences to overshoot with a "cytokine storm".

This storm is an over-activation of white blood cells, which release too-great amounts of cytokines -- inflammation-stimulating molecules --into the blood, they said.

"Similar to what happens after infection with SARS and MERS, data show that patients with severe COVID-19 may have a cytokine storm syndrome," said study author Daishun Liu, Professor at Zunyi Medical University in China.

"The rapidly increased cytokines attract an excess of immune cells such as lymphocytes and neutrophils, resulting in an infiltration of these cells into lung tissue and thus cause lung injury," Liu said.

The researchers explained that the cytokine storm ultimately causes high fever, excessive leakiness of blood vessels, and blood clotting inside the body.

It also causes extremely low blood pressure, lack of oxygen and excess acidity of the blood, and build-up of fluids in the lungs, they said.

The researchers noted that white blood cells are misdirected to attack and inflame even healthy tissue, leading to failure of the lungs, heart, liver, intestines, kidneys, and genitals.

This multiple organ dysfunction syndrome (MODS) may worsen and shutdown the lungs, a condition called acute respiratory distress syndrome, (ARDS), they said.

This, the researchers explained, happens due to the formation of a so-called hyaline membrane -- composed of debris of proteins and dead cells -- lining the lungs, which makes absorption of oxygen difficult.

Most deaths due to COVID-19 are therefore due to respiratory failure, they said.

The researchers explained that in the absence of a specific antiviral cure for COVID-19, the goal of treatment must be to the fight the symptoms, and lowering the mortality rate through intensive maintenance of organ function.

For example, an artificial liver blood purification system or renal replacement therapy can be used to filter the blood through mechanical means, they said.

The team noted that especially important are methods to supplement or replace lung function, for example with non-invasive mechanical ventilation through a mask, ventilation through a tube into the windpipe, the administration of heated and humidified oxygen via a tube in the nose, or a heart-lung bypass.

The researchers stressed the importance of preventing secondary infections.

They noted that SARS-Cov-2 also invades the intestines, where it causes inflammation and leakiness of the gut lining, allowing the opportunistic entry of other disease-causing microorganisms.

The researchers advocate that this should be prevented with nutritional support, for example with probiotics -- beneficial bacteria that protect against the establishment of harmful ones -- and nutrients and amino acids to improve the immune defences and function of the intestine.

"Because treatment for now relies on aggressive treatment of symptoms, preventative protection against secondary infections, such as bacteria and fungi, is particularly important to support organ function, especially in the heart, kidneys, and liver, to try and avoid further deterioration of their condition," Liu added.
